Method for downloading and using a communication application through a web browser

Inactive Publication Date: 2011-01-27
VOXER IP
View PDF101 Cites 94 Cited by
  • Summary
  • Abstract
  • Description
  • Claims
  • Application Information

AI Technical Summary

Benefits of technology

[0015]The invention involves a method for downloading a communication application onto a communication device. Once downloaded, the communication application is configured to create a user interface appearing within one or more web pages generated by a web browser running on the communication device. The communication enables the user to engage in voice conversations in (i) a real-time mode or (ii) a time-shifted mode and provides the ability to seamless transition the conversation back and forth between the two modes (i) and (ii). In the real-time mode, the communication application is configured to transmit voice media as the user speaks and render voice media as it is transmitted and received from a sender. The communication application also provides for the persistent storage of transmitted and received voice media. With persistent storage, the voice media may be rendered at a later arbitrary time defined by the user in the time-shifted mode.
[0017]In another embodiment, both the communication device and communication servers responsible for routing the voice media of the conversation between participants are “late-binding”. With late-binding, voice media is progressively transmitted as it is created and as soon as a recipient is identified, without having to first wait for a complete discovery path to the recipient to be discovered. Similarly, the communication servers can progressively transmit received voice media as it is available, before the voice media is received in full, as soon as the next hop is discovered, and before the complete delivery route to the recipient is fully known. Late binding thus solves the problems with current communication systems, including the (i) waiting for a circuit connection to be established before “live” communication may take place, with either the recipient or a voice mail system associated with the recipient, as required with conventional telephony or (ii) waiting for an email to be composed in its entirety before the email may be sent.

Problems solved by technology

The called party can pick up the phone while the caller is leaving a message, which causes most answering machines to stop recording the message.
In either situation, there is no way for the called party to review the recorded message until after the recording has stopped.
As a result, there is no way for the recipient to review any portion of the recorded message other than the current point while the message is ongoing and is being recorded.
There is no way to review previous portions of the message before the message is left in its entirety.
While the answering machine functionality has been integrated into the phone, the limitations of these answering machines, as discussed above, are still present.
If the user does not hear the message, for whatever reason, the message is irretrievably lost.
These systems, however, typically do not record messages that are reviewed live by the recipient.
Although it is possible to send time-based (i.e., media that changes over time, such as voice or video) as an attachment to an email, the time-based media can never be sent or reviewed in a “live” or real-time mode.
Real-time communication is therefore not possible with conventional email.
However with either Skype voice mail or Hot Recorder, it is not possible for a user to review the previous media of the conversation while the conversation is ongoing or to seamlessly transition the conversation between a real-time and a time-shifted mode.
Neither the instant messaging, nor the mobile phone applications, however, allow users to conduct voice and other time-based media conversations in both a real-time and a time-shifted mode and to seamlessly transition the conversation between the two modes.

Method used

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
View more

Image

Smart Image Click on the blue labels to locate them in the text.
Viewing Examples
Smart Image
  • Method for downloading and using a communication application through a web browser
  • Method for downloading and using a communication application through a web browser
  • Method for downloading and using a communication application through a web browser

Examples

Experimental program
Comparison scheme
Effect test

Embodiment Construction

[0031]The invention will now be described in detail with reference to various embodiments thereof as illustrated in the accompanying drawings. In the following description, specific details are set forth in order to provide a thorough understanding of the invention. It will be apparent, however, to one skilled in the art, that the invention may be practiced without using some of the implementation details set forth herein. It should also be understood that well known operations have not been described in detail in order to not unnecessarily obscure the invention.

Messages and Conversations

[0032]“Media” as used herein is intended to broadly mean virtually any type of media, such as but not limited to, voice, video, text, still pictures, sensor data, GPS data, or just about any other type of media, data or information. Time-based media is intended to mean any type of media that changes over time, such as voice or video. By way of comparison, media such as text or a photo, is not time-b...

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
Login to view more

PUM

No PUM Login to view more

Abstract

A method of enabling communication over a network by maintaining a server on a network and receiving a request at the server from a user of a communication device. In response to the request, a communication application is downloading over the network to the communication device. The communication application enabling the user to participate in a conversation on the communication device in either (i) a real-time mode or (ii) a time-shifted mode and (iii) to seamlessly transition the conversation between the two modes (i) and (ii).

Description

CROSS-REFERENCE TO RELATED APPLICATIONS[0001]This application is a Continuation-in Part (CIP) of U.S. application Ser. No. 12 / 028,400, filed Feb. 8, 2008, which claims the benefit of priority to U.S. Provisional Applications 60 / 937, 552, filed Jun. 28, 2007, and 60 / 999,619, filed Oct. 19, 2007. This application is also a CIP of U.S. application Ser. No. 12 / 561,089, filed Sep. 16, 2009, which claims the benefit of priority to U.S. Provisional Patent Application No. 61 / 232,627, filed Aug. 10, 2009. This application is further a CIP of U.S. application Ser. Nos. 12 / 419,861, filed Apr. 17, 2009, 12 / 552,980, filed Sep. 2, 2009, and 12 / 857,486, filed Aug. 16, 2010, each of which claim priority to U.S. Provisional Application No. 61 / 148,885, filed Jan. 30, 2009. The above-listed provisional and non-provisional applications are each incorporated herein by reference for all purposes.BACKGROUND[0002]1. Field of the Invention[0003]This invention pertains to communications, and more particularl...

Claims

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
Login to view more

Application Information

Patent Timeline
no application Login to view more
IPC IPC(8): H04L12/66G06F3/01
CPCH04L12/1831H04L12/581H04L51/04H04L65/604H04L65/1083H04L65/4015H04L51/32H04L51/52H04L65/764
Inventor KATIS, THOMAS E.PANTTAJA, JAMES T.PANTTAJA, MARY G.RANNEY, MATTHEW J.
Owner VOXER IP
Who we serve
  • R&D Engineer
  • R&D Manager
  • IP Professional
Why Eureka
  • Industry Leading Data Capabilities
  • Powerful AI technology
  • Patent DNA Extraction
Social media
Try Eureka
PatSnap group products